How Can An Enlarged Uterus And Vaginal Bleeding Be Treated?

I have been scheduled for a D&C and an exam under anesthesia. My Dr. could not perform an exam because my uterus is overgrown with fibroids. I am 54 and often experience vaginal bleeding on ocassion, also I am menopausal and have been since the age of 38.

General & Family Physician 's  Response
Hi,

Multiple fibroids with recurrent vaginal bleed are best managed with laparoscopic hysterectomy for lifetime cure.
